Bookkeeping (Pakistan)
Monthly bookkeeping for Pakistani entities — ledgers, reconciliations and management accounts — kept audit-ready and aligned with FBR and SECP requirements from day one.
Who needs this
Pakistani companies and AOPs, startups that want clean books before their first audit or raise, and foreign subsidiaries whose parent needs reliable local numbers.

How we deliver
Step by step.
01
Setup
Chart of accounts built to serve both management reporting and statutory/tax needs.
02
Monthly cycle
Transactions processed, banks reconciled, and a monthly pack delivered.
03
Tax alignment
Books kept so sales tax, withholding and income-tax filings fall out of them naturally — no year-end reconstruction.
04
Audit readiness
Schedules and support maintained continuously, so the statutory audit is a formality, not a project.

Frequently asked questions
Can you work in our existing software? +
Yes — QuickBooks, Xero and local setups alike; if you have nothing, we'll recommend the simplest tool that fits.
Do the books connect to our tax filings? +
That's the point — one set of books feeds sales tax, withholding statements and the annual return, so the numbers always agree with each other.
